Italian luxury fashion brand Prada last week terminated its contract with Chinese actress Zheng Shuang over a suspected scandal.

The move comes in the context of a surrogacy row. Some reports alleged that Zheng split up with her partner and abandoned her two children born to surrogates abroad. It must be noted that surrogacy is illegal in China. As a result of the controversy, Prada Hong Kong stocks began to fall and closed down by 1.7 percent at HK$46.20 on January 18. Though the stocks rebounded the next day, Prada still announced the termination of the contract on its official Weibo account and deleted solo posts of Zheng from the social media platforms.
